關系型數據庫和非關系型數據庫的主要區別在于數據存儲結構和查詢方式,關系型數據庫使用表格形式存儲數據,通過SQL語言進行查詢,具有嚴格的數據結構和一致性約束,非關系型數據庫則以鍵值對、文檔、列族等形式存儲數據,支持靈活的查詢和高并發讀寫,但缺乏嚴格的數據結構和一致性約束。
免責聲明:
本網站致力于提供合理、準確、完整的資訊信息,但不保證信息的合理性、準確性和完整性,且不對因信息的不合理、不準確或遺漏導致的任何損失或損害承擔責任。本網站所有信息僅供參考,不做交易和服務的根據, 如自行使用本網資料發生偏差,本站概不負責,亦不負任何法律責任。
發表評論
2024-06-25 23:07:10回復
以下是兩者的主要區別: 關系性數據庫中,所有數據都存儲在表中且相互之間存在某種聯系(如父子、一對一等),這種結構使得查詢和管理復雜的數據集變得更為方便和高效;但面對海量數據時可能會存在性能瓶頸或復雜性挑戰等問題出現頻率較高的概率更大一些表現不是很靈活對于應對動態變化的業務需求可能會有一定的難度在非關系的開放設計系統中可以利用無結構化模型去簡化系統設計使之能夠輕松地存儲并管理大數據可以省去不必要的浪費在那些常規類型的索引和其他處理過程的投入因此比起適應高度依賴表的SQL的關系數倉它的應用則更適合以開源API的方式進行存取管理和配置維護更方便此外NoSql中的集合內部的編碼更加方便的去組裝那么它從正反兩種面的介紹上就達成了總結的不同!二者各有優勢關鍵要看你的需求更偏向于哪種場景和業務特點來決定使用哪一種技術方案實現數據管理優化及升級開發的目標。"